Barber's half dollar began as a mirror-image copy of the Morgan dollar head, though cropped off most of Miss Anna Willess Williams's hair and concealed the rest within an enlarged cap. Barber also removed the assorted vegetable matter from the brim of the cap (retaining the word LIBERTY), replacing the various stalks with a simple laurel wreath, placing IN GOD WE TRUST above.<BR><BR>For the reverse, Barber improved on Robert Scot's work of 91 years earlier by refashioning the Great Seal of the United States. His earlier patterns (dated 1891, Judd 1766, 1765, 1764, 1762) ret ained the clouds above eagle; his final design (as seen here) dropped them, reducing an otherwise crowded effect to tolerable levels. <BR>Estimated Value $4,500-5,000. <BR><BR>Our item number 102037<BR><IMAGES><P ALIGN="CENTER"><IMG SRC="http://goldbergcoins.net/liveauction/37jpegs//102037.jpg"> <BR><IMG SRC="http://goldbergcoins.net/liveauction/37jpegs//102037N2.jpg"> </P></IMAGES>
